Automated Webpage Scraping: A Thorough Manual

The world of online content is vast and constantly expanding, making it a significant challenge to personally track and gather relevant information. Automated article scraping offers a powerful solution, permitting businesses, analysts, and people to quickly obtain significant amounts of online data. This guide will explore the basics of the process, including several techniques, critical platforms, and vital aspects regarding ethical concerns. We'll also analyze how machine processing can transform how you process the internet. In addition, we’ll look at ideal strategies for enhancing your harvesting performance and avoiding potential issues.

Create Your Own Python News Article Extractor

Want to easily gather reports from your preferred online sources? You can! This project shows you how to construct a simple Python news article scraper. We'll take you through the procedure of using libraries like bs and reqs to retrieve titles, content, and images from targeted websites. Not prior scraping knowledge is required – just a fundamental understanding of Python. You'll discover how to manage common challenges like changing web pages and bypass being blocked by platforms. It's a wonderful way to streamline your research! Besides, this initiative provides a solid foundation for learning about more advanced web scraping techniques.

Discovering Source Code Repositories for Article Extraction: Best Picks

Looking to automate your article extraction process? Git is an invaluable platform for coders seeking pre-built solutions. Below is a selected list of repositories known for their effectiveness. Quite a few offer robust functionality for downloading data from various online sources, often employing libraries like Beautiful Soup and Scrapy. Consider these options as a foundation for building your own personalized harvesting workflows. This collection aims to present a diverse range of approaches suitable for various skill levels. Note to always respect online platform terms of service and robots.txt!

Here are a few notable archives:

  • Web Extractor System – A comprehensive framework for creating robust scrapers.
  • Basic Article Harvester – A user-friendly solution ideal for those new to the process.
  • JavaScript Web Scraping Utility – Designed to handle intricate online sources that rely heavily on JavaScript.

Harvesting Articles with Python: A Hands-On Guide

Want to simplify your content collection? This comprehensive tutorial will show you how to extract articles from the web using Python. We'll cover the essentials – from setting up your setup and installing required libraries like bs4 and the requests module, to writing reliable scraping scripts. Learn how to navigate HTML pages, identify target information, and preserve it in a accessible layout, whether that's a CSV file or a data store. Regardless of your limited experience, you'll be equipped to build your own web scraping solution in no time!

Automated Content Scraping: Methods & Software

Extracting news content data efficiently has become a essential task for analysts, editors, and companies. There are several techniques available, ranging from simple HTML extraction using libraries like Beautiful Soup in Python to more sophisticated approaches employing webhooks or even AI models. Some common platforms include Scrapy, ParseHub, Octoparse, and Apify, each offering different amounts of customization and processing capabilities for data online. Choosing the right method often depends on the source structure, the volume of data needed, and the desired level of automation. Ethical considerations and adherence to site terms of service are also essential when undertaking press release harvesting.

Article Scraper Creation: Code Repository & Python Resources

Constructing an content scraper can feel like a intimidating task, but the open-source scene provides a wealth of assistance. For people inexperienced to the process, GitHub serves as an incredible center for pre-built solutions and packages. Numerous Programming Language extractors are available for forking, offering a great starting point for the own unique program. One will find instances using packages like BeautifulSoup, Scrapy, and the requests module, all scraper info of which simplify the gathering of information from web pages. Besides, online guides and documentation are plentiful, allowing the understanding significantly gentler.

  • Review Code Repository for existing harvesters.
  • Get acquainted yourself with Python packages like BeautifulSoup.
  • Leverage online materials and guides.
  • Explore the Scrapy framework for more complex projects.

Leave a Reply

Your email address will not be published. Required fields are marked *